Channels in Photoshop
Just as James Clerk Maxwell's experiment in the 1860s created color, so too
does a digital camera. However, instead of three separate images, we now
have separate channels within the same image i le composited together to
create the full color spectrum of an image. Separated, they are the individual
color “plates” that make up the image's color. A color image typically contains
four color channels: a Red channel, Green channel and Blue channel,
creating the “RGB” composite, and a fourth channel composite of all three.
This composite channel allows you to view any one of the individual colors
independently, or any combination of all three. There are i ve color channels
within a CMYK image (cyan, magenta, yellow, black and the combo of all four).
These channels store all the color information for each individual pixel within
an image and are generated automatically by Photoshop.
